Sumario:This book bridges the gap between theory and clinical application for electro-acoustic and electro-physiologic assessment of hearing loss across the age range. Strategies and techniques for screening and diagnosis of hearing loss are presented clearly and simply. It is a one-stop resource for clinicians who are responsible for the diagnostic auditory assessment of children and adults.
